Vulnerability Description

Adobe Acrobat Reader versions 15.020.20042 and earlier, 15.006.30244 and earlier, 11.0.18 and earlier have an exploitable memory corruption vulnerability in the XFA engine related to a form's structure and organization. Successful exploitation could lead to arbitrary code execution.
